Flow Tools

Thomas H. Ptacek, who co-authored a slightly famous paper on IDS several years ago, wrote me regarding his company's product, Peakflow X. According to their press release, the system profiles network traffic and complements traditional signature-based IDS:


"Upon installation, Peakflow X monitors network traffic, automatically constructing a holistic real-time model of the entire network from the inside out. Identifying factors such as services (HTTP, FTP, Microsoft File Sharing, etc.), inbound and outbound traffic, and host-to-host behavior, Peakflow X dynamically clusters all hosts into groups based on similar operational policies. For example, hosts that communicate primarily HTTP only to hosts in the marketing department would be grouped together, indicating an organization’s internal workgroup Web servers. Based on this detailed network-wide model, Peakflow X immediately detects anomalous behavior whether or not it stems from a known vulnerability. For example, should one of the internal Web servers initiate a file sharing connection to a system on the Internet, Peakflow X would immediately flag the activity as suspicious. As a result, Peakflow X can detect not only zero-day threats, like worms, but also internal misuse."


This seems like one of the best ways to deal with inspecting huge traffic flows. Problems with CISSP Questions

The June 2003 Information Security Magazine offered some great reading too. It reminded me of a Gartner statistic saying between 60 to 70 percent of Windows Server users run NT 4. Writing about his experience taking the CISSP exam, Andrew Briney nails the problem with CISSP questions:


"There's a chunk of questions that are difficult for all the wrong reasons. They're poorly worded, misleading or simply evasive. Evasive: that's the word that first came to mind when I walked out of the exam. It just seems like these questions serve no purpose other than to confuse and frustrate you.

It's because of these questions that you won't have an intuitive sense if you passed the exam. And it's because of these questions that the CISSP exam often gets a bad rap. Even though these questions comprise a comparatively small part of the exam, they're the ones that stick in your craw as you walk out the door."


I learned while reading Thomas Ptacek's commentaries of this article blasting the CISSP. I maintain that the main redeeming aspect of the CISSP is its code of ethics, which moves digital security closer to being a true profession with a code of ethics that matters.

Security "Return on Investment"

The June 03 SC Magazine offered several excellent articles. Peter Stephenson discusses new forensic certifications, like the Certified Information Forensics Investigator (CIFI). (If you qualify by 31 Dec 03, you might be able to grandfather the cert without sitting for the test.) The same issue featured a case study called Tracking Down Cybercriminals. Unfortunately, SC Magazine quotes an Addamarkl survey saying "companies are unwilling to prosecute hackers, even when they have enough evidence for legal action. Information security departments said they preferred to fix the damage or use forensic evidence to achieve a settlement with the wrongdoer, rather than opt for legal proceedings." This is too bad, as an article by Mark Doll of E&Y discusses the effect of security incidents on share prices. In short, within three days of X, share prices dropped by Y:



  • "significant security breach": 5.6%, or $15-$20 million on average

  • "theft of credit card data": 15%

  • "denial of service": 3.6%

  • "theft of customer information": 1.2%



Finally, I say forget all this talk about security providing "return on investment." Page 15 of the Deloitte Touche Tohmatsu 2003 Global Security Survey shows 63% of executives see security as "a necessary cost of doing business." Only 13% say security is "an investment in enabling infrastructure."

Guess and FTC Settlement

The SANS and Neohapsis Security Alert Consensus told me of the settlement between Guess and the FTC. From the article:


According to the FTC complaint, since at least October 2000, Guess' Web site has been vulnerable to commonly known attacks such as "Structured Query Language (SQL) injection attacks" and other web-based application attacks. Guess' online statements reassured consumers that their personal information would be secure and protected. The company's claims included "This site has security measures in place to protect the loss, misuse, and alteration of information under our control" and "All of your personal information, including your credit card information and sign-in password, are stored in an unreadable, encrypted format at all times." In fact, according to the FTC, the personal information was not stored in an unreadable, encrypted format at all times and Guess' security measures failed to protect against SQL and other commonly known attacks. In February 2002, a vistor to the Web site, using an SQL injection attack, was able to read in clear text credit card numbers stored in Guess' databases, according to the FTC.
